Transaction 17b4db236b8af98eec63a31b224dc9fabd280903a86eedbed71f140acc714d5a
1 Input
2 Outputs
- 17b4db236b8af98eec63a31b224dc9fabd280903a86eedbed71f140acc714d5a:0
- 17b4db236b8af98eec63a31b224dc9fabd280903a86eedbed71f140acc714d5a:1
value 55479
address 32RmHLMd8GXKeAHvWkRkNXt9H4RhJ1Grrh
value 93684
address 1ECjGc31gSwsdtST9M5Y3qxmQEBKY3VAUm